Property Management Insights: Challenges, Burnout, and Strategies with Carrie Viseur
Lisa McGrath and Carrie Viseur dive into property management, comparing practices in the US and Canada. They tackle challenges like taking vacations, staffing issues, poaching, turnover, and burnout. Carrie shares insights on building board relationships, conflict resolution, and essential skills for managers. The discussion extends to AI's role, managing contractor expectations, handling homeowner complaints, and addressing water damage and restoration. The episode wraps up with plans for a follow-up on burnout.
Key Points
- Property managers often face burnout due to the overwhelming volume of emails and calls they need to handle daily.
- The key to effective property management lies in cultivating strong relationships with boards and homeowners, which includes clear communication and conflict resolution.
- Differences in pay and operational practices between property management in the US and Canada can impact job satisfaction and turnover rates among managers.
